non-fatal error if some datasource can't be run (i.e. journalctl but systemd is missing) (#2309)

This on the other hand, gives a new fatal error when there are no valid datasources.
In the previous version, crowdsec kept running with just a warning if no
acquisition yaml or dir were specified.

type DataSourceUnavailableError struct {
Name string
Err error
}
func (e *DataSourceUnavailableError) Error() string {
return fmt.Sprintf("datasource '%s' is not available: %v", e.Name, e.Err)
}
func (e *DataSourceUnavailableError) Unwrap() error {
return e.Err
}
